ok. for the beat lock to work fully you need to have the "advanced tempo" engaged

but the "advanced tempo" is pretty finicky.. if the computer & sound card can't handle the latency your telling it to take in, you start to get "pops" and "crackles"

thats why I asked about the latency, if the RMX is using ASIO drivers, then 10ms should be fine?

on my computer and music I use, I usually try not to go past +/- 6%

I would say about? 10 to 20% of the songs I have can not be brought past 10% or I hear a noticiable digital distortion.

Almost all of my .VOB files seem to handle the beat lock a lot better, probably because the video is being uncompressed by the CPU AND the audio is PCM (which is pretty close to a WAVE file).

I have noticed I can improve response if I re-rip the music to a higher bit rate like 320 kbps..

sometimes its just the song.. I have a couple of songs that I can hear digital distortion on even at 0% change.. I switch off beatlock and it goes away.. (distortion not bad enough for the avg customer can hear, but I notice it)

actually, that was how I chose my settings for VDJ.. I picked one of the songs that seemed to perform the WORST under beatlock and then played around with the settings untill I could get at least +/- 3% change.. after that, my other thousands of songs sounded great!

Of course, what I am talking about is distortion caused by the key changer type effect. (which is how beat lock works)
where as, Pops and clicks and misses are usually caused by a latency problem.

Well I had to set the RMX Latency to 30ms and in VDJ i set it to high quality, and auto for latency. everything else pretty much advanced with master tempo at 0,0.

This gave me the best results with perfect beat lock and almost no crackles at all.

30ms does seem a bit high....but oh well im just happy it works.
